Protein synthesis inhibitors usually act at the ribosome level, taking advantage of the major differences between prokaryotic and eukaryotic ribosome structures. Protein synthesis inhibitors are substances that disrupt the processes that lead directly to the generation of new proteins in cells. Various classes of drugs grouped under protein synthesis inhibitors include aminoglycosides, tetracyclines and glycylcyclines, chloramphenicol, macrolides, and ketolides, lincosamides, streptogramins, oxazolidinones, spectinomycin, mupirocin, fusidic acid, and pleuromutilins.
